Brick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design and installation of durable, visually appealing features made from brick materials to enhance outdoor spaces. Typical projects include patios, walkways, garden borders, retaining walls, fire pits, and other landscape elements that add structure and character to residential properties. Homeowners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create functional outdoor living areas, or define different zones within a yard.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ners should consider the overall style of their home, the intended use of the space, and any specific design preferences or functional needs, such as drainage or durability requirements.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ects is essential for property owners interested in these services. Key factors include the size and layout of the area to be developed, the type of brick or materials preferred, and the level of customization desired. It is also helpful to consider existing landscape features and how the new hardscape will integrate with them. Clarifying these details can assist in planning a project that aligns with aesthetic goals and practical considerations, ensuring a successful and satisfying outdoor upgrade.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as that add durability and style.
How durable is brick for outdoor hardscaping? Brick is known for its strength and weather resistance, making it a long-lasting option for various outdoor surfaces.
Can brick hardscaping complement existing landscaping? Yes, brick structures can seamlessly integrate with existing landscapes, enhancing the overall property appearance.
What maintenance is required for brick hardscaping? Brick surfaces generally require minimal upkeep, with occasional cleaning and weed control to maintain their appearance.
